We are currently partnering with our trusted client, Adolfson and Peterson Construction Company , for an Executive Assistant to the President, Midwest/SE Region, located in their beautiful corporate offices in Bloomington, Minnesota ( transitioning to their new offices located in Edina, Minnesota, late 2026) Adolfson & Peterson Construction (AP) is a fourth-generation, family-owned business founded in 1946 in the basement of George Adolfson and Gordon Peterson in Richfield, Minnesota, now a $1.5 billion company and growing . Today, AP operates from 12 locations across the United States and is consistently recognized as an Engineering News-Record (ENR) Top 100 Contractor, known for excellence in safety, innovation, and quality. For more than 75 years, AP has delivered complex, high-profile projects across commercial, healthcare, education, and industrial sectors. At the core of its success is a steadfast commitment to building strong, collaborative relationships and consistently exceeding client expectations. With more than 800 team members nationwide, AP remains deeply rooted in its founding values as a family-owned company. Duties and Responsibilities Provide confidential, Executive Administrative support to the President, Midwest/SE Region by calendar management, arranging travel, email support, scheduling meetings, preparing communications and reports, and performing executive-level administrative functions. Serve as administrative point of contact for the Regional President. Routinely interact with the highest levels of the organization, shareholders, clients, and community and organization leaders while coordinating projects, meetings, and phone calls with executives. This position requires tact and confidentiality, as the Executive Assistant will have access to sensitive information about the organization and its employees, as well as clients, trade partners, and other relevant parties. Calendar Management: Proactively manage a complex calendar, including arranging, confirming, and adjusting meetings and coordinating all required logistics, protecting the President’s time and managing priorities. Meeting Planning: Coordinate executive-level meetings, including scheduling and preparation of agendas, executive reports, and supporting documentation; develop and compile materials for the President’s presentation at the Board meetings using PowerPoint. Create and develop PowerPoint presentations and draft and format reports in Excel. Record ELT meeting minutes, track action items, and coordinate meeting logistics, including scheduling, conference rooms, catering, and room setup. Travel Arrangements: Schedule and coordinate travel and associated logistics, including flights, hotel, transportation, and meals. Expenses: Prepare and submit expense reports, ensuring accuracy and timely processing. Communication: Serve as the primary liaison and trusted thought partner to the President, managing communications, priorities, and confidential matters. Draft executive correspondence, conduct research, and prepare communications while representing the President and Leadership Team with professionalism, discretion, and sound judgment. Document Management: Facilitate and manage the flow of documents requiring executive signatures, ensuring timely review, organization, and tracking of signed materials while coordinating with team members to meet deadlines. Establish and maintain filing systems; retrieve data and respond to requests for information. Project Management: Manage projects and/or be a collaborative committee team member on projects. Partner with the Regional Leadership Team to align project prioritization. Assist with tracking and managing client and industry relationships using a CRM to support meaningful connections through thoughtful touchpoints. Lead continuous improvement within executive processes and administration. Event Planning: Plan, organize, and execute complex regional and client events, including the annual golf outing and company-sponsored functions such as the annual meeting, holiday celebration, and regional leadership retreat, ensuring a high-quality and seamless experience. Additional Administrative Support: Demonstrate a team-first mindset by providing administrative and office support, coordinating new hire onboarding with HR and IT, assisting with front desk coverage, supporting satellite offices, and contributing wherever needed to ensure a seamless workplace experience.
